### **1. What’s Included in the Set?**
This set includes **eight waterproof reference cards**, each illustrating step-by-step instructions for tying different fishing knots. The knots covered range from basic (e.g., Improved Clinch Knot, Palomar Knot) to more advanced (e.g., Bimini Twist, Albright Special). The cards are designed to be **durable, water-resistant, and easy to carry**, making them ideal for on-the-go anglers.
### **2. Build Quality & Durability**
One of the standout features is the **waterproof and tear-resistant material**. Unlike paper guides that degrade in wet conditions, these cards can withstand rain, splashes, or even accidental drops in the water. The **laminated finish** ensures clarity, preventing smudges from dirty or wet hands.
### **3. Ease of Use**
The **visual step-by-step diagrams** are clear and well-illustrated, making knot-tying intuitive even for beginners. Each card is **compact (roughly credit-card sized)**, allowing easy storage in a tackle box, pocket, or attached to a lanyard. The **color-coded system** helps quickly identify different knot categories (e.g., loop knots, terminal knots).

### **5. Price vs. Value**
Priced at around **$10–$15**, the Kylebooker set is **affordable** compared to buying multiple knot-tying books or apps. While free online tutorials exist, they often require internet access and lack the convenience of a **physical, waterproof guide**. For the price, the durability and practicality make it a **cost-effective tool** for both novice and experienced anglers.
### **6. Potential Drawbacks**
– **Limited advanced techniques**: While it covers essential knots, extreme specialists (e.g., deep-sea anglers) might need supplemental guides.
– **No storage case**: The cards are sturdy but could benefit from a small protective pouch.
